About the Air Quality Index
0–50 Good
51–100 Moderate
101–150 Unhealthy for Sensitive Groups
151–200 Unhealthy
201–300 Very Unhealthy
301–500 Hazardous

The U.S. AQI runs 0–500. The overall value equals the highest individual pollutant sub-index, and the dominant pollutant is the one driving it. PM2.5 (fine particles) is reported in µg/m³ and ozone (O3) in ppb. Forecast source: NWS NAQFC.
